2017-05-05 1 views
0

오래된 역방향 프록시 (연결 당 스레드 모델)로 인해 클라이언트 연결을 오래 동안 열어 둘 수 없습니다.http 연결을 오래 동안 열어 둘 수 없을 때 AsyncResult 사용

브라우저 요청으로 인해 처리되는 데 3 분이 소요되는 비동기식 EJB 메소드가 호출된다고 가정 해 봅니다. 반환 된 Future을 여전히 활용할 수 있습니까? 다른 요청을 통해 액세스 할 수 있도록 어딘가에 저장해야합니까?

이 문제를 해결하기위한 좋은 방법은 무엇입니까?

답변

0

요청을 3 분간 기다리는 것이 좋지 않습니다. 당신은 서버에서 클라이언트를 호출 할 수있는 signalr 종류의 것을 더 잘 사용할 수 있습니다.

관련 문제